Transaction df852d34ee37269cf2636155b140d36e76cd1bf8636bacf52d52311d766d3f96

2 Input
1 Outputs
  • df852d34ee37269cf2636155b140d36e76cd1bf8636bacf52d52311d766d3f96:0
  • value  735000
    address  3GDJjBnQjWauQeKpgc5Hb22SyMd5y4xtpQ